What are everyone's opinions right now on taking a large group of Warriors vs a smaller set of Immortals? I've got a tournament coming up in a couple of weeks and can't really decide whether to take a single group of 20 reaper Warriors or two 5-man squads of Immortals. I like the firepower of the Warriors (I use Eternal Expanionists and a really aggressive, melee heavy list) but the Immortals are both cheaper and slightly tougher. 

 

In my specific case, the plan was to use the 20-man Warrior blob with an Overlord to charge up the middle, somewhat as a distraction from my Skorpehks and Canoptek constructs flanking both sides. I already have a 5-man squad of Immortals as a back-field objective holder, but am wondering if I should just swap out the Warriors for a 10-man squad of Immortals to do the same thing for less points (and the saved points into other units).

 

Overall, what are peoples opinions of the two? Do you like running Immortals or Warriors more?

20 man warrior blobs are still one of the more potent units we can rock. Play them right using cover and keep on them using a cheap res-orb from a lord and a ghost ark, and as long as you use line of sight blockers and terrain, you can make this unit extremely difficult to shift. Coupled with the ghost ark, the GA is not a direct threat but it can be a movement blocker, the gauss racks can be annoying, its a distraction carnifex, and often takes the heat off the warriors in a notable, defensive way. Having said that, I still use a couple units of 5-man immortals as cheap obsec objective grabbers. I don't expect much from their guns, but I get more use from this setup vs. large units of immortals and small/zero units of warriors. 

 

I just find that when you drop the warrior blob for immortals, and this is the main troop the enemy has to contend with, its just easier for them to take out wholesale to deny reanimation.

It depends a bit upon your meta (are people running msu Custodes, or plasma inceptors & max wyches) as to which has survivability advantages.

 

I do think that a 20 strong warrior blocks is worth planning around (I.e. do you have a res orb or technomancer nearby) and some kind of plan for being close up and personal (I.e. being novokh or having a Royal warden nearby)
